Help Keep Neighbors Warm

As temperatures begin to cool, Border Bank is once again inviting community members to help local families prepare for winter through its Annual Winter Warmth Drive, running September 21 through October 16, 2026.

The bank is collecting new or gently used coats, jackets, hats, mittens, gloves, and winter boots for children and adults. Donations may be dropped off at any Border Bank location and will be distributed through local organizations serving those in need.

"Our communities have always stepped up to support one another, and we're proud to continue this tradition," said Kory Shae, CEO of Border Bank. "Every donation helps provide warmth, comfort, and dignity to a neighbor facing the challenges of a northern winter."

Shae added, "The generosity we see each year is a great reminder of what makes our communities special. Together, we can make a meaningful difference for local families."

Founded in 1935, Border Bank has grown into a trusted financial partner with eleven branches across North Dakota and Minnesota. With two locations in Fargo, ND, and nine throughout MN, including Coon Rapids, Thief River Falls, Greenbush, Roseau, Badger, Middle River, Clearbrook, Baudette, and International Falls, Border Bank remains deeply rooted in the communities it serves.

In addition to its banking services, Border Bank proudly owns Northern Ag, an insurance agency dedicated to strengthening the financial security of American farmers. Through innovative risk management tools, Northern Ag helps agricultural producers navigate uncertainty and protect what matters most.
